17470 Children's Titles Part of the Oxford StudiesBarbauld [1743 1825] was a political writer, poet, teacher, essayist, edictor and critic. Running a school with her husband in a Suffolk village, she revolutionized the nation's ideas about childhood with books she wrote that sold thousands. Living in the time of the American and French Revolutions, Napoleonic Wars, and struggles for religious equality, she strove to defend Enlightenment principles with her essays, and political writings.
